Summary:
The book presents the history of the fabulous group "Los Peinados Yoli", a gay group of performing artists. A group that renewed theatrical aesthetics through varieté and monologues. Formed initially by Patricia Gatti, Fernando Arroyo and Mario Filgueira, later Divina Gloria and Rony Arias join. The group's work, which lasts until 1987, starts from parody and comedy, exploiting the costumes, hairstyles and proximity to the public. Its members define themselves as clowns determined to transmit joy.
